The **Certificate in Cost Analysis for Design for Manufacturing (DFM)** is in high demand in the UK, with cost analysts (DFM) taking the lion's share of the job market. The role involves analyzing and managing the costs associated with manufacturing products, ensuring that companies maintain profitability while delivering quality goods. The following roles are also relevant in the industry, although they may have slightly different focuses and responsibilities: * Manufacturing Engineer: A manufacturing engineer is responsible for designing, implementing, and improving manufacturing processes. This role may overlap with cost analysis for DFM, particularly when it comes to identifying cost-saving measures. * Supply Chain Analyst: Supply chain analysts focus on improving the efficiency of supply chains, from sourcing raw materials to delivering finished products. This role may involve cost analysis and management, particularly when it comes to reducing transportation and logistics costs. * Procurement Specialist: Procurement specialists are responsible for sourcing and purchasing goods and services for their organizations. This role may involve cost analysis, particularly when it comes to negotiating contracts and identifying cost-saving opportunities. According to recent salary surveys, cost analysts (DFM) in the UK can expect to earn between £30,000 and £60,000 per year, depending on their level of experience and the size and industry of their employer. Manufacturing engineers, supply chain analysts, and procurement specialists can also earn competitive salaries, with similar ranges depending on experience and industry. In terms of skill demand, cost analysis and DFM skills are highly valued in a variety of industries, including manufacturing, engineering, and technology. Employers in these industries are looking for professionals who can analyze complex manufacturing processes, identify cost-saving opportunities, and manage budgets and expenses effectively. Other in-demand skills for these roles include project management, data analysis, and communication skills.
